朝霞网

首页 > 行业资讯 / 正文

延时程序编写

2025-12-17 16:25:38 行业资讯

在现代信息化的社会中,智能编程技术正日益成为提高工作效率的重要手段。延时程序编写就是一个非常实用的技巧。**将深入探讨延时程序编写的方法和技巧,帮助读者解决实际操作中的问题,提升编程能力。

一、延时程序编写的概念与意义

1.1什么是延时程序编写

延时程序编写,即在程序中设置一段代码在特定时间后执行。这种编程方式在处理一些需要等待特定条件满足的任务时尤为有效。

1.2延时程序编写的意义

通过延时程序编写,可以提高程序的执行效率,避免资源浪费,同时还能简化程序逻辑,降低代码复杂度。

二、实现延时程序编写的方法

2.1使用定时器函数

在大多数编程语言中,都提供了定时器函数来实现延时功能。以下是一些常用编程语言的定时器函数示例:

-Python:time.sleep(seconds)

-JavaScript:setTimeout(function,milliseconds)

-Java:newTimer().schedule(newTimerTask(){...},delay)

2.2利用事件循环

在一些支持事件循环的编程语言中,可以通过设置延时事件来实现延时程序编写。以下是一些示例:

-JavaScript:setInterval(function,milliseconds)

-Python:schedule.every(seconds).do(some_task)

2.3使用异步编程

异步编程是一种通过回调函数或Promise对象来实现非阻塞操作的技术。在异步编程中,可以实现延时程序编写。以下是一些示例:

-JavaScript:asyncfunctiondelay(seconds){returnnewPromise(resolve=>setTimeout(resolve,seconds*1000))

-Python:asyncdefdelay(seconds):awaitasyncio.sleep(seconds)

三、延时程序编写的注意事项

3.1确保延时时间准确

在编写延时程序时,要注意确保延时时间的准确性。特别是在涉及到时间敏感的操作时,要充分考虑系统时间误差等因素。

3.2避免无限延时

在编写延时程序时,要避免无限延时的情况。这可能会导致程序陷入死循环,影响正常执行。

3.3合理使用资源

在实现延时程序编写时,要注意合理使用系统资源,避免资源浪费。

四、

**通过深入探讨延时程序编写的概念、方法和注意事项,为读者提供了实用的编程技巧。掌握这些技巧,有助于提高编程能力,优化程序性能。希望读者能将这些知识运用到实际编程中,提升工作效率。

网站分类